Bible Verses about “sober minded”
Found 10 verses (ordered by relevance) about “sober minded” in the KJV version of the Bible
“And be not conformed to this world: but be ye transformed by the renewing of your mind, that ye may prove what [is] that good, and acceptable, and perfect, will of God.”
“¶ Be sober, be vigilant; because your adversary the devil, as a roaring lion, walketh about, seeking whom he may devour:”
“And be not drunk with wine, wherein is excess; but be filled with the Spirit;”
“A bishop then must be blameless, the husband of one wife, vigilant, sober, of good behaviour, given to hospitality, apt to teach;”
“Teaching us that, denying ungodliness and worldly lusts, we should live soberly, righteously, and godly, in this present world;”
“¶ Wherefore gird up the loins of your mind, be sober, and hope to the end for the grace that is to be brought unto you at the revelation of Jesus Christ;”
“That the aged men be sober, grave, temperate, sound in faith, in charity, in patience.”
“Young men likewise exhort to be sober minded.”
“¶ But the end of all things is at hand: be ye therefore sober, and watch unto prayer.”
“¶ Therefore let us not sleep, as [do] others; but let us watch and be sober.”
